Add enable-real-ip
This commit is contained in:
parent
6982d72c40
commit
d52141c2b9
4 changed files with 123 additions and 1 deletions
|
|
@ -479,6 +479,9 @@ type Configuration struct {
|
|||
// Sets whether to use incoming X-Forwarded headers.
|
||||
UseForwardedHeaders bool `json:"use-forwarded-headers"`
|
||||
|
||||
// Sets whether to enable the real ip module
|
||||
EnableRealIp bool `json:"enable-real-ip"`
|
||||
|
||||
// Sets the header field for identifying the originating IP address of a client
|
||||
// Default is X-Forwarded-For
|
||||
ForwardedForHeader string `json:"forwarded-for-header,omitempty"`
|
||||
|
|
@ -712,6 +715,7 @@ func NewDefault() Configuration {
|
|||
EnableUnderscoresInHeaders: false,
|
||||
ErrorLogLevel: errorLevel,
|
||||
UseForwardedHeaders: false,
|
||||
EnableRealIp: false,
|
||||
ForwardedForHeader: "X-Forwarded-For",
|
||||
ComputeFullForwardedFor: false,
|
||||
ProxyAddOriginalURIHeader: false,
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ue